Official NWS forecasts for August 23 in New York City project a high near 82°F under mostly cloudy skies with a 50% chance of showers and thunderstorms, particularly in the afternoon, creating the main driver for the near-even split between the 82–83°F (38.5%) and 80–81°F (36.5%) bins. Model consensus shows humid conditions with light winds shifting southwest, which can suppress peak readings if convection develops early or enhance them during breaks in cloud cover. Historical August norms around 82–84°F provide context, yet recent days’ variable precipitation and the inherent spread in short-term model runs sustain trader uncertainty between these closely matched outcomes while assigning low probability to extremes above 85°F or below 78°F.

The resolution source for this market will be information from NOAA, specifically the highest reading under the "Temp" column for all times on this day, available here: https://www.weather.gov/wrh/timeseries?site=klga
To toggle between Fahrenheit and Celsius, click the "Switch to US Units w/ kts" button until the relevant table displays °F.
This market can not resolve until the first data point for the following date has been published on the resolution source.
The resolution source for this market measures temperatures to whole degrees Fahrenheit (eg, 21°F). Thus, this is the level of precision that will be used when resolving the market.
Revisions to temperatures recorded within this market's timeframe will be considered until the first datapoint for the following date has been published, after which any alterations will not be considered.
